Joined
·
8,026 Posts
The Invicta car company has delivered its first customer car. Just 11 months after the prototype was unveiled at last year's Birmingham motor show.
More pictures here
The Invicta S1 is powered by a 4.6-litre, 32-valve Ford Mustang V8 engine which produces around 320 bhp!
Now this would make a sweet slot car!

More pictures here
The Invicta S1 is powered by a 4.6-litre, 32-valve Ford Mustang V8 engine which produces around 320 bhp!
Now this would make a sweet slot car!